Letter and mail boxes are an essential feature of any property; whether its letters, bills, newspapers or parcels, a mail box facilitates the receiving of information easily.

Property owners need to decide whether to fit a traditional letter box in the front door of the property, or install a contemporary postbox outside.

The traditional letterbox with clapper has a large aperture capable of receiving A4 post without folding the envelope, yet it still has the charm and elegance of a period letterplate.

Fitting a letter box is not the easiest of DIY tasks but approached with care it can be done in both wooden doors and PVC doors alike. The biggest problem with fitting a letter box is the fear you face when cutting a huge hole in your door!

Contemporary post boxes made from brushed stainless steel are extremely weather resistant and look fantastic. Stainless steel mail boxes are durable for many decades and are generally the best value post boxes over a longer period of time. Post boxes come in a variety of shapes and sizes, to suit the type of post you tend to receive.

Post boxes are suitable for houses, apartment blocks and offices. A multi occupancy post box can sit neatly beside, below or on top of another forming bank of post boxes.
